After over a decade climbing the corporate ladder, I know firsthand how easy it is for health and wellbeing to slip to the bottom of the priority list.

 

Behind the scenes of a high-flying, ambitious career, I struggled with growing physical and mental health challenges that no promotion or payslip could fix.

It wasn’t a crash diet or extreme overhaul that turned things around - it was small, sustainable changes to my nutrition, training and lifestyle. Changes that helped me reclaim my energy, rebuild my strength and restore a sense of balance I didn't think was possible.

 

Realising how many women were silently facing the same battles, I traded my corporate career for a new mission: launching Wai Way to empower women to take control of their health without sacrificing their ambitions, culture or identity.

 

Today, I coach women who are ready to stop choosing between career success and personal wellbeing.


Together, we build strength, energy and confidence — while embracing carbs, cultural foods and the unique vision each woman holds for her body and life.

 

At The Wai Way, there’s no one-size-fits-all "ideal body". So, whether your goal is fat loss, muscle gain, improved fitness or simply feeling good in your own skin, I'm here to support your version of success — not society’s.

As a mixed-race Guyanese woman, I'm also passionate about increasing body and cultural diversity in the health and fitness space; representation matters - and I’m here to disrupt outdated narratives and create a more inclusive, empowering landscape for women from all backgrounds.
